Aude Moreau (born 5 August 1990 in Neuilly-sur-Seine) is a French football player who currently plays for French club Saint-Étienne of the Division 1 Féminine.[1] She is a former graduate of the women's section of the Clairefontaine academy and plays as a midfielder. Moreau has been with her current club since the start of the 2010–11 season after spending two seasons with Montigny-le-Bretonneux. She has starred for several youth women's international teams for her country and played with the under-20 team at the 2010 FIFA U-20 Women's World Cup.
